Javier Milei’s former advisor had criticized the vice president in a 2024 publication; “Karina Milei was always right,” she had written
Victoria Villarruel again used social networks to launch messages against sectors linked to the national government, this time after the arrest of Fernando Cerimedo in Bolivia. The vice president reacted in X to a publication that recovered an old message from the former presidential adviser of Javier Milei, in which Cerimedo expressed his support to Karina Milei, secretary general of the Presidency and one of the central figures of the libertar…
The Vice-President referred to the Secretary-General's link with the consultant currently detained in Bolivia for attempted femicide.

Buenos Aires, 18 August (NA) -- Vice President Victoria Villarruel pointed ironically against Fernando Cerimedo, former advisor to Javier Milei, who was charged on Tuesday with attempted femicide by the Bolivian Public Prosecutor's Office due to an attack in which his former partner, Nadia Beller, received three shots.
